CréditAgricole S.A

Eric Caen, Chief Digital Officer

Navigating Digital Challenges

Eric Caen has been the Chief Digital Officer of the CréditAgricole S.A. Group since November 2020. He is responsible for digital strategy, data, artificial intelligence, and digital innovation.

Eric Caen is the co-founder of Titus Interactive video game group (1985-2005). He led Glowria, a specialist in video-on-demand services, and helped McDonald’s (2011-2015), Vimpelcom (2015-2016) and CMA-CGM (2017-2018) accelerate their digital transformations. Self-taught, Eric was named Entrepreneur of the Year France by Ernst & Young in 1998 and created the digital transformation index for French blue-chip (CAC40) companies, published by Forbes in June 2017 and November 2019.

Following is the conversation with Caen.

Could you provide an overview of your role and responsibilities within the company?

Since 2020, I am the Chief Digital Officer of CréditAgricole group, and in charge of some of the IA, Data, design and development, digital technologies, agile, and innovation of the largest financial group in Europe…

What are some of the key challenges you face?

Challenging the routines, proposing concrete solutions that could help drive change forward, making complex technology easy to understand and accepted by the deciders then by users (colleagues & customers)

What would you say are some of the futuristic trends that will have an impact in the next 18-24 months?

Impact of generative AI and how to make sure we go the extra mile to refine the best usages for most people Introduction of new kind of assistant or bots, reaching high level of precision and qualitative interactions

Challenge the routines, propose concrete solutions that could help changing for good, making complex technology easy to understand and accepted by the deciders then by users (colleagues & customers).

What advice would you give to young professionals who are interested in pursuing a similar career, and what qualities do you think are essential for success in this field?

Curiosity! Invest enough time in testing new things (even coding new things), learn how to remain ahead of the curve, and develop a network by providing support each time it is needed.
